PREGNANCY TIPS BY DR REKHA AGRAWAL (MSGynae. , Gold Medalist) Your first tip: As soon as you suspect you’re pregnant, see your doctor and visit Pregnancy and Childbirth at Advanced GYNAE center indore. prenancy tips at home 1-Take a prenatal vitamin 2-Exercise regularly 3-Write a birth plan 4-Track your weight gain (normal weight gain is 25-35 pounds) 5-Eat folate-rich foods (lentils, asparagus, oranges, fortified cereals) 6-Eat calcium-rich foods (dairy, canned fish, soy) 7-Eat foods with fiber 8-Don’t eat soft cheeses (unpasteurized styles like Brie and feta may contain bacteria that can cause fever, miscarriage or pregnancy complications) Eat your veggies 9-Eat five or six well-balanced meals each day But don’t overeat. You only need 300-500 additional calories per day. Keep a food diary. 10-Limit caffeine 11-Drink plenty of fluids (six 8-ounce glasses of water per day) prenancy 12-Don’t drink alcohol & Don’t smoke; 13-Get enough sleep 14-Wear your seatbelt 15-Don’t take over-the-counter medications or herbal remedies without medical consultation 16-Practice relaxation techniques daily (yoga, stretching, deep breathing, massage) 17-Don’t overmedicate Exercise, but don’t overdo it Stretch before bed to avoid leg cramps Take a picture of yourself before the baby arrives
